Dungeon Ghyll Force: Waterfall Height: 40ft+ Elevation: 350m: Nearest Village: Chapel Stile: Grid Ref: NY 287 068: Dungeon Ghyll Force is a tall and impressive waterfall in a ravine to the north west of New Dungeon Ghyll. The closest car park to Whorneyside Force is at the National Trust car park at Old Dungeon Ghyll, postcode LA22 9JY (part of the car park belongs to the pub, so make sure you park in the right place). Below Dungeon Ghyll Immortalized by Wordsworth who penned his poem 'The Idle Shepherd Boy' in reference to it, the waterfall can be reached via a highly scenic path which leads off from that leading to Stickle Tarn.
